利用斯通利波衰减反演渗透率的方法改进

摘    要:利用严格的Biot介质模型,针对阵列声波测井情况,建立了基于物理统计方法的利用斯通利波幅度衰减反演储层渗透率之线性化最小二乘反演模型。作为对方法可行性的检验,运用该方法对理论合成数据进行了处理,结果表明运用统计方法后反演渗透率的偏差变小,证明了方法的可行性。

Improvement in Inversion of Permeability from Attenuation of Stoneley Waves

Abstract:Using Biot model to describe the permeable formation around a borehole,a linear least-square method for inversion permeability from borehole Stoneley waves,attenuations is improved by introducing the physical statistic into choosing amplitude ratio for array acoustic logging data.In order to test probability of the improved method,the synthetic full waveforms are processed.The results show that it is a feasible method to evaluate the permeability because of the smaller relative error.
